If the type
of the selected Class/Examined Field is numeral (for example - "Cash"),
you will be asked to create Classes manually with the help of controls on
this page.
You can easily add, edit or remove Classes before their Ccreation, or
recreate them in case if you've made some mistakes.
- "From(min)" edit - put in the minimum value for the
created Class.
- "To(max)" edit - put in the maximum value for the
created Class..
- "Add Class to the List" button - adds the values (from "From(min)" and "To(max)"
controls)
to the "Classes List".
- "Classes List" control - displays the list of Classes
to be created.
The content of this control can be edited with the help of buttons on the
right: "Delete from the List" and "Clear "Classes
List"" buttons.
- "Delete from the List" button - pressing this button will
remove the selected Class from the "Classes List".
- "Clear "Classes List" button - removes all Classes from the
"Classes List".
- "View Field Values" button - press this button to
view statistics for values met in the class field.

Step 3. Fields Selection
|
|
 |
Next step is
selecting the fields to be used for analysis. For example: if fields
"Company Name" and "Address" are not selected, then no
Decision Rules or
Decision Trees will be created with the
use of these fields.
It is important to mark fields, that might contain important
information.
For example: "Company Name" field can be marked, but it is
expected, that it will contain unique text values that do not correlate with
other values. More important in this case are fields that contain
economic or statistical data. Class field is marked with red color.
Fields, that are not recommended for
use, are marked with grey color. |

Step 5. Query Settings
|
|
 |
To find out
how to start working with settings view "Getting
Started". Depending on
the Type of the Query you have selected you will be asked to form Query
Settings.
In case if you have selected Rules Query, the"Rules Query Settings"
page will be shown.
- "Element belongs to class(%)" - input the
probability for Decision Rules.
- "Minimum number of cases for a Rule" - the rules,
describing less than minimum number of cases, will be ignored by the program.
- "Float fields minimum value" - determines
minimum rational values that Estard Data Miner will use for the analysis.
- "Maximum Rules number for a Class" - this control allows to
limit the number of created Rules. For example, if setting controls value
to 10, the program will create no more than 10 Rules for each Class.
|
 |
If you have
selected Decision Tree Query, the "Decision Tree
Query Settings" page will be displayed .
Decision Trees can be created in various ways.
- "Build Automatically" control- mark it if
you want the program to decide how to create the Decision Tree.
- "Build Tree for Each Field" control - mark it if you want
to recieve a Decision Tree for each Field, marked in the "Selection of Fields"
control. Time, necessary to obtain Decision Trees is proportional to number of Fields used in analysis
processing.
- "Build starting with Field" control - mark it to create a concrete Decision Tree, strarting with the Field selected
in the list below the control.
- "Build a Single Tree" - in case if some Classes were
not defined after building the first Tree, Estard Data Miner will try to build
a new Tree. Marking this control will make Estard Data Miner to create a single
Decision Tree.
- "Stop After defining All Classes" control - will stop
Decision Trees creation in case if all Classes were defined.
Decision Tree Output Settings:
- "Clear previous Trees before adding new ones" option - clears up the
displayed Decision Trees before adding
new Decision Trees.
- "Add new Decision Trees to previously created" - if
some Decision Trees are displayed in the control on the "Decision Tree
Output" page, they won't be removed when creating a new Tree.
|
 |
Exceptions
settings allow to set the program to search for exceptions from dependencies
in data. You also can make the program to search for exceptions only for
classes met in some number of cases. "Search for exceptions"
control - allows to turn on and off exceptions searching.
"Minimum number of Class cases" control - Classes, met in less
number of cases than set in this control, will not be searched for
exceptions.
"Minimum exception difference(%)" control - allows to set the
program sensitivity to exceptions.
"Other classes occurance for exception" - how many cases of other classes
can be met for the exception. |
